In Which of the following case , A Straight line slope will be upward given linear equation is Y = a+bX.
Solution
The slope of a straight line in a linear equation Y = a + bX will be upward when the coefficient b is positive.
Here's the step by step explanation:
-
In the linear equation Y = a + bX, 'b' is the slope of the line.
-
The slope of a line is a measure of how steep the line is.
-
If 'b' is positive, the line will slope upwards as we move from left to right on the graph. This is because for every increase in X, Y increases (since we're adding a positive number to Y).
-
If 'b' is negative, the line will slope downwards as we move from left to right on the graph. This is because for every increase in X, Y decreases (since we're adding a negative number to Y).
-
If 'b' is zero, the line is horizontal. This is because no matter what value X takes, Y always remains the same (since we're adding zero to Y).
So, in the case of the linear equation Y = a + bX, the slope of the line will be upward if 'b' is positive.
